Diego Córdoba 🇦🇷<p>Sabías que podés configurar tu firewall <a href="https://mstdn.io/tags/nftables" class="mention hashtag" rel="nofollow noopener" target="_blank">#<span>nftables</span></a> en Linux usando <a href="https://mstdn.io/tags/Python" class="mention hashtag" rel="nofollow noopener" target="_blank">#<span>Python</span></a> ?</p><p>Sí, se puede hacer usando <a href="https://mstdn.io/tags/libnftables" class="mention hashtag" rel="nofollow noopener" target="_blank">#<span>libnftables</span></a>, librería provista directamente por el proyecto <a href="https://mstdn.io/tags/netfilter" class="mention hashtag" rel="nofollow noopener" target="_blank">#<span>netfilter</span></a>. </p><p>Qué cantidad de posibilidades brinda esto para la configuración y obtención de info de nuestro firerwall en Linux!</p><p>¿Para qué lo usarías?</p><p><a href="https://mstdn.io/tags/gnu" class="mention hashtag" rel="nofollow noopener" target="_blank">#<span>gnu</span></a> <a href="https://mstdn.io/tags/linux" class="mention hashtag" rel="nofollow noopener" target="_blank">#<span>linux</span></a> <a href="https://mstdn.io/tags/AprenderLinux" class="mention hashtag" rel="nofollow noopener" target="_blank">#<span>AprenderLinux</span></a> <a href="https://mstdn.io/tags/aprender_linux" class="mention hashtag" rel="nofollow noopener" target="_blank">#<span>aprender_linux</span></a> <a href="https://mstdn.io/tags/learnlinux" class="mention hashtag" rel="nofollow noopener" target="_blank">#<span>learnlinux</span></a> <a href="https://mstdn.io/tags/juncotic" class="mention hashtag" rel="nofollow noopener" target="_blank">#<span>juncotic</span></a> <a href="https://mstdn.io/tags/educacion" class="mention hashtag" rel="nofollow noopener" target="_blank">#<span>educacion</span></a> <a href="https://mstdn.io/tags/softwarelibre" class="mention hashtag" rel="nofollow noopener" target="_blank">#<span>softwarelibre</span></a> <a href="https://mstdn.io/tags/opensource" class="mention hashtag" rel="nofollow noopener" target="_blank">#<span>opensource</span></a></p>